Example Calculation
Let's consider a hypothetical circumstance where a financier wants to invest ₤ 10,000 in SCHD, which has an annual dividend yield of 3.5%:
Investment AmountDividend YieldApproximated Annual DividendsApproximated Monthly Dividends₤ 10,0003.5%₤ 350₤ 29.17
In this case, the financier can anticipate to earn approximately ₤ 350 annually or ₤ 29.17 monthly from their financial investment in SCHD.

What is SCHD's dividend yield?
As of late 2023, SCHD has an approximate dividend yield of 3.5%. However, this number can vary, so checking the most recent figures is suggested.
2. How typically does SCHD pay dividends?
SCHD pays dividends quarterly.
3. Can I reinvest dividends received from SCHD?
Yes, numerous brokers use dividend reinvestment strategies (DRIPs) that instantly reinvest dividends into extra shares of SCHD, helping with compounding growth.
